1 definition by Neonia

Fits in nowhere and everywhere. Unique, definite one-of-a-kind, yet relates to most everyone. Loves life. Loves all things fun and pretty and funny and beautiful. Loves hearing people's stories and looking at photos of their lives. Appreciates anyone who has walked off the beaten path. Loves art and creativity.
You're so easy to please, you're like a Marsea.
by Neonia February 2, 2010
Get the Marsea mug.